Truss repair services involve assessing and fixing the structural framework that supports a building’s roof. Trusses are engineered components that transfer the weight of the roof to the walls, ensuring stability and safety. When a truss becomes damaged or compromised, it can lead to sagging ceilings, uneven floors, or even structural failure if not addressed promptly. Skilled service providers evaluate the extent of the damage, identify the underlying causes-such as wood rot, pest infestation, or weather-related stress-and carry out repairs that restore the integrity of the roof support system. Proper repair work can help prevent more extensive damage and maintain the safety of the property.
Many common problems can signal the need for truss repair services. These include visible sagging or bowing ceilings, cracks in interior walls, or doors and windows that no longer open and close properly. In some cases, homeowners may notice unusual noises during high winds or heavy rain, which could indicate compromised roof support. Additionally, signs of water damage, such as staining or mold growth, might suggest that a truss has been weakened by moisture infiltration. Addressing these issues early with professional repairs can help avoid costly structural failures and extend the lifespan of the property’s roof system.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or truss repairs or reinforcement range from $250-$600 for many routine jobs. Most projects in this category f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ed.
Moderate Repairs - Mid-sized repairs, such as replacing sections of damaged trusses, usually cost between $600-$1,500. Larger, more involved projects tend to push into this range, especially in homes with multiple problem areas.
Full Truss Replacement - Replacing an entire truss can range from $2,000-$5,000 or more, depending on the size of the structure and complexity. Many full replacements fall into this higher tier, particularly for larger or more complex roof systems.
Complex or Custom Projects - Extensive repairs or custom truss fabrication can exceed $5,000, with costs varying based on design requirements and building specifics. These higher-end projects are less common but are handled by specialized local contractors.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
